- 博客(50)
- 收藏
- 关注
转载 快速转载CSDN中的博客
在参考“如何快速转载CSDN中的博客”后,由于自己不懂html以及markdown相关知识,所以花了一些时间来弄明白怎么转载博客,以下为转载CSDN博客步骤和一些知识小笔记。 参考博客原址:http://blog.csdn.net/bolu1234/article/d...
2021-03-18 09:02:07 82
转载 oracle 中translate的基本用法
oracle 中translate的基本用法1.translate 与replace类似是替换函数,但translate是一次替换多个单个的字符。2.基本用法,字符对应替换。3.如果 没有对应字符则替换为null;4.如果对应字符过多,不影响5.如果替换字符整个为空字符 ,则直接返回null6.如果想筛掉对应字符,应传入一个不相关字符,同时替换字符也加一个相同字符;7,如果相同字符对应多个字符,按第一个;8,如果想保留某些特定字符筛选掉其他的,比如筛掉汉字保留数字9,还有其他灵活用法,比如我可以判断两个字符
2020-12-04 15:11:35 1746
原创 virtualbox+vagrant环境安装linux 和 docker
virtualbox+vagrant环境安装dockervirtualbox安装vagrant安装docker安装linux安装docker安装virtualbox安装参考地址:官网:https://www.virtualbox.org/安装步骤:https://jingyan.baidu.com/article/25648fc19e948d9191fd00a7.htmlvagrant安装一路下一步安装即可(可自定义安装目录)vagrant官网:https://www.vagrantup.com
2020-11-26 12:43:49 216
原创 IDEA常用快捷键
Alt+Enter:自动提示完成,抛出异常Alt+Insert:产生构造方法,get/set方法等Ctrl+Alt+T:将选中的代码使用if,while,try/catch等包装Ctrl+Shift+=:展开所有代码Ctrl+Shift±:收缩所有代码Ctrl+F12:显示当前文件的文件结构Ctrl+B:定位至变量定义的位置Ctrl+G:定位到文件某一行Ctrl+N:查找类文件Ctrl+Shift+N:查找文件Ctrl+Alt+L:格式化代码Ctrl+Alt+I:自动缩进行Ctrl+
2020-09-09 17:20:00 100
转载 JAVA使用POI导出百万级别数据
用过POI的人都知道,在POI以前的版本中并不支持大数据量的处理,如果数据量过多还会常报OOM错误,这时候调整JVM的配置参数也不是一个好对策(注:jdk在32位系统中支持的内存不能超过2个G,而在64位中没有限制,但是在64位的系统中,性能并不是太好),好在POI3.8版本新出来了一个SXSSFWorkbook对象,它就是用来解决大数据量以及超大数据量的导入导出操作的,但是SXSSFWorkbook只支持.xlsx格式,不支持.xls格式的Excel文件。这里普及一下,在POI中使用HSSF对象时,ex
2020-08-06 10:09:44 582
转载 2020-08-05
redis简介1.基于内存的key-value数据库2.基于c语言编写的,可以支持多种语言的api //set每秒11万次,取get 81000次3.支持数据持久化4.value可以是string,hash, list, set, sorted set使用场景去最新n个数据的操作排行榜,取top n个数据 //最佳人气前10条精确的设置过期时间计数器实时系统, 反垃圾系统pub, sub发布订阅构建实时消息系统构建消息队列缓存cmd访问redisredis-cli -h 1
2020-08-05 14:36:00 113
原创 oracle常用sql语句
查看数据库版本select version from Product_Component_Version where SUBSTR(PRODUCT,1,6) = ‘Oracle’查询临时表空间信息select TABLESPACE_NAME “表空间名称”,round(TABLESPACE_SIZE / (1024 * 1024 * 1024), 2) “临时表空间大小(G)”,roun...
2019-12-18 10:24:20 96
转载 git常用命令
git常用命令汇总git init //初始化本地git环境git clone XXX//克隆一份代码到本地仓库git pull //把远程库的代码更新到工作台git pull --rebase origin master //强制把远程库的代码跟新到当前分支上面git fetch //把远程库的代码更新到本地库git add . //把本地的修改加到stage中git commi...
2019-12-18 10:14:13 67
原创 java项目框架包含的内容
基础框架选型(springboot)引入插件(maven+mybatis+mybatis-geneator)配置异常处理配置日志制订开发规范(封装传参和返回值模板)
2019-12-18 09:36:35 282
转载 Spring Boot2.x + Druid动态数据源切换
Spring Boot2.x + Druid动态数据源切换1、数据源配置<!-- alibaba的druid数据库连接池 --> <dependency> <groupId>com.alibaba</groupId> <artifactId>druid-spring-boot-starter</artifactI...
2019-08-09 10:21:31 798
转载 Spring-Boot 访问外部接口的几种方案
一、简介在Spring-Boot项目开发中,存在着本模块的代码需要访问外面模块接口,或外部url链接的需求,针对这一需求目前存在着三种解决方案,下面将对这三种方案进行整理和说明。二、Spring-Boot项目中访问外部接口2.1 方案一 采用原生的Http请求在代码中采用原生的http请求,代码参考如下:@RequestMapping("/doPostGetJson")pu...
2019-07-23 11:49:17 1245
转载 sql执行顺序
sql中执行顺序一、sql执行顺序二、mysql的执行顺序一、sql执行顺序(1)from(3) join(2) on(4) where(5)group by(开始使用select中的别名,后面的语句中都可以使用)(6) avg,sum…(7)having(8) select(9) distinct(10) order by从这个顺序中我们不难发现,所有的 查询语句都是从f...
2019-07-12 11:32:10 198
转载 springBoot中利用AOP切面设置全局事务
package test.spring.config;import java.util.Collections;import java.util.HashMap;import java.util.Map;import org.springframework.aop.Advisor;import org.springframework.aop.aspectj.AspectJExpress...
2019-07-12 11:24:46 402
原创 通过swagger将接口导入postman教程
通过swagger将接口导入postman教程更新最新的manager-base项目(已集成swagger工具)。依次启动eureka-server、cloud-zuul、manager-base项目。打开浏览器,输入http://localhost:8083/base/swagger-ui.html地址如图,找到对应元素的连接,并复制连接:打开...
2019-04-25 14:18:22 10239
原创 导入Excel
@Override public Integer importExcel(MultipartFile file) { List<TalkBaseInfoEntity> tVos = new ArrayList<>(); Workbook workbook = null; String fileName = file.g...
2019-04-25 14:15:13 92
原创 使用mybatis自动生成代码
从svn更新最新代码,已引入mybatis-generator插件,pom文件如下图:配置Intellij IDEA的运行配置,新增一个maven执行操作,如下图:修改generatorConfig.xml文件,如下图:然后选中刚配置的 maven运行选项,点运行...
2019-04-25 10:36:23 132
转载 解决本地开启多个服务致电脑卡顿方案
解决本地开启多个服务致电脑卡顿方案 2018-09-20 Write By jwwang修改server.port及eureka地址 修改eureka-server下application.yml中端口号,添加 instance instance: instance-id: ${spring.cloud.client.ipAddress}:${server...
2019-04-25 10:30:54 875
原创 @Transactional 事务处理注解详解
@Transactional 事务处理注解详解一、 事物注解方式: @Transactional当标于类前时, 标示类中所有方法都进行事物处理,例子:@Transactionalpublic class TestServiceBean implements TestService {}当类中某些方法不需要事物时:@Transactionalpublic c...
2019-04-25 10:28:22 15762
原创 Feign使用
Feign使用1.启动类添加注解:@EnableFeignClients2.配置路由访问权限3.调用配置4.使用(1)注入接口(2)调用5.manager-web方法
2019-04-25 10:26:54 103
转载 Java多线程干货系列—(一)Java多线程基础
Java多线程干货系列—(一)Java多线程基础Java多线程前言多线程并发编程是Java编程中重要的一块内容,也是面试重点覆盖区域,所以学好多线程并发编程对我们来说极其重要,下面跟我一起开启本次的学习之旅吧。正文线程与进程1 线程:进程中负责程序执行的执行单元线程本身依靠程序进行运行线程是程序中的顺序控制流,只能使用分配给程序的资源和环境2 进程:执行中的程序一...
2019-04-20 17:25:51 182
转载 HTML5的LocalStorage和sessionStorage的使用
1、HTML5的LocalStorage和sessionStorage的使用
2019-04-18 11:05:59 158
转载 @RequestParam、@RequestBody和@ModelAttribute区别
1、@RequestParam、@RequestBody和@ModelAttribute区别
2019-04-18 11:04:50 184
转载 java Session和Cookie 简单介绍
1、Java Session 简单介绍2、理解Cookie和Session机制3、jquery.cookie() 方法的使用(读取、写入、删除)
2019-04-18 10:08:05 88
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人